Industrial Machine Vision
The 10M25DCF484C8G's 25,000 logic elements and 360 user I/Os in a 484-BGA package make it well-suited to industrial machine vision pipelines. Designers can implement CoaXPress, GigE Vision, or Camera Link aggregation directly in the fabric, with the abundant M9K block RAM (691 Kbits total) absorbing line buffers and frame headers before forwarding data via LVDS or external DDR memory. The -8 speed grade supports the high fMAX needed for pixel-clock domain crossing at 200-300 MHz, while the on-chip flash configuration enables instant-on for line-scan cameras that must be ready before the conveyor starts moving.

Motor Control and Drive
Field-oriented control (FOC) loops for three-phase motors demand deterministic, sub-microsecond computation - exactly what the 10M25DCF484C8G delivers via parallel fabric execution. Its 18x18 hardware multipliers (DSP blocks) handle Park/Clarke transforms and PID loops in parallel, while 360 I/Os support encoder, Hall-sensor, and PWM-channel fan-out for multi-axis drives. The instant-on behavior from on-chip flash removes boot latency that SRAM FPGAs incur, critical for safety-rated drive startups. The 484-BGA package also routes cleanly to gate-driver PCBs with controlled impedance.

Factory Automation Backplane Bridges
Protocol-bridging nodes between Profinet, EtherCAT, Modbus TCP, and legacy fieldbus segments fit naturally on the 10M25DCF484C8G. With 25K logic elements the device can host several soft-IP stacks concurrently, and the 484-BGA provides the pin budget needed for parallel multi-port bridging (RJ45, fiber, RS-485) without external muxing. The non-volatile flash eliminates the boot PROM and lets the bridge come online within milliseconds - important for deterministic industrial restart behavior. The -8 speed grade sustains 100 Mbps Ethernet MAC timing closure comfortably.

Design Notes
The 484-BGA package uses 1.0 mm ball pitch. Designers should adopt a 4-layer or 6-layer PCB stack-up with a dedicated ground plane directly under the device, and use via-in-pad with filled/capped vias for the inner-row BGA balls. Power decoupling requires 100 nF X7R capacitors within 1 mm of every VCCIO/VCCINT ball group, plus bulk 10 uF tantalum or ceramic at each voltage rail. Failure to provide proper decoupling risks power-supply noise coupling into the PLL and SERDES blocks.
Estimated: At -8 speed grade with all 25K LEs running at 200 MHz toggle rate and typical 30% switching activity, internal dissipation reaches approximately 1.5-2.0 W. The 484-BGA package's theta_JA (approximately 12-15 C/W with appropriate thermal vias and copper pour) yields a junction temperature rise of 25-30 C above ambient. Industrial designs should populate the full thermal-via array under the BGA exposed pad region to maintain a low junction-to-ambient thermal resistance.
Do not confuse the 'C8G' suffix ordering code with the -6 or -7 speed grades - the trailing '8' refers to the speed bin, not the temperature grade. Always verify the full OPN against the Intel MAX 10 ordering code reference. Mixing up speed grades can break timing closure on critical paths such as DDR3 interfaces. Also confirm Quartus Prime version supports the specific device-package-pin combination before PCB commitment.
